Paul Smith is one of Britain’s leading independent design companies, driven by a spirit of curiosity, playfulness, adaptability and passion.

These values shape every aspect of the brand, whether it’s a shirt, a shop or a special collaboration.

Reaffirming the values that Paul set down in 1970, ‘classic with a twist’ remains the guiding principle of the company.

Happily positioned between high fashion and formalwear, while taking reference from both, Paul Smith has always been proud to stand apart.

As Assistant Manager you will effectively support the Store Manager in the overall running and operations of the Woodbury Commons Shop in Central Valley, NY.

This role will help to achieve and exceed set financial targets and is responsible for ensuring exceptional customer service levels are consistent through driving a focused and knowledgeable team.

  • What you’ll be doing
  • To liaise and communicate with the Corporate team regarding financial budgets and weekly reports relating to the shop as directed.
  • To ensure weekly financial & performance reports are accurately completed and communicated to the rest of the team.
  • To ensure that the shop complies with the Company’s Health & Safety Policy. This will involve liaison with the Shop Manager, and the Company’s Health & Safety Officer.
  • To have an awareness and understanding of the Company’s disciplinary procedures as stated in the Company Handbook.
  • To maintain and increase sales throughout the year and achieve set financial & key performance target by maintain an excellent level of customer service at all times within the shop.
  • To act as an ambassador for the brand and shop within the neighborhood and be aware of all relevant events and important periods for the market.
  • To support marketing on execution of local marketing initiatives.
  • To assist the Shop Manager and ensure in their absence, that the department and shop has the correct levels of stock and that replenishment orders are placed, as required, in close liaison with the Retail Operations team.
  • To assist the Shop Manager and ensure in their absence, that the shop is always merchandised to the Company’s desired standard and that, with liaison with the Display & VM Department, the shop displays are changed weekly.
  • To effectively manage the shop staff in close liaison with the Shop Manager and HR with all matters relating to recruitment, induction, training, discipline and appraisals.
  • To assist the Store Manager with the creation of store schedules and management of payroll by approving time cards on a biweekly basis.
  • To ensure that the staff are given relevant product training throughout the year.
  • To maintain, in the Shop Manager’s absence, close communication with the Buying Office, Press Office and Retail Office, to ensure that up to date and relevant information is relayed.

Who you are

  • Minimum 5+ years' experience in a luxury RTW retail environment in a management position
  • Experience working with tailoring for Men's and Women's clothing.
  • Ability to manage shop during absence of the Shop Manager in every respect.
  • Ability to interpret sales related data and reporting.
  • Working knowledge of retail management systems and Microsoft Office.
  • Proven track record in delivering excellent customer service, increasing and maintaining sales.
  • Excellent grasp of all retail standards & procedures- front and back of house, and stock management.
  • Experience in training associates, recruitment, and performance management.
  • High level interest in the Paul Smith brand.
  • Ability to be an ambassador for Paul Smith.
  • Passion for style and fashion and retail in general.
  • Has ability to motivate team; self-motivated & enthusiastic.
  • Self-starter with good planning & organizational skills.
  • Able to work flexible hours to meet business demands if required.
